Chaim Fuks / Harry Fox (M / Poland, 1930), Holocaust survivor

Biography

Jonah Fuks (1928) and Chaim Fuks (1930) were born in Tuszyn, near Lodz, Poland. From the Piotrkow Ghetto they were deported to KZ Czestochowa, Buchenwald, and Nordhausen>. In the closing days of the war, Chaim was sent Theresienstadt, where he was liberated. Jonah instead managed to go back to Poland and from there reached his brother at Theresienstadt.

As orphans, both brothers were included among the Windermere Children who in August 1945 went to England. Chaim remained in England, while Jonah moved to the United States in 1956.
